Abstract

The partner of this service program was the second semester students of Business English Study Program, Faculty of Language and Literature, State University of Makassar. The problem of partner was the lack of knowledge regarding conformity between noun and pronoun in an English sentence so that they continue to make mistakes in writing or expressing an English sentences. The expected outcome was the students have an understanding of noun-pronoun agreements in English and can make English sentences correctly both in oral and written form. The approach used in conducting this program consisted of two methods, namely the presentation and practice. The results achieved were the participants (1) have knowledge and understanding that are likely not at the same level regarding the basic theories of noun-pronoun agreement, (2) are able to adjust between pronoun with the noun that precedes the pronoun (antecedent) in an English sentence, and (3) around 95% are able to do exercises in accordance with the theories in oral or written form even though some of them or about 5% are sometimes still wrong in writing or saying the sentence in English.

Abstract

Social media has grown rapidly and affects our everyday life. It helps many aspects in our life, including students’ life. Instagram, one of the top platforms to use in the world recently, can be brought to the classroom for student’s learning purpose. Therefore, this research aims to specifically investigate students’ perception toward its usefulness and ease for writing practice. The sample was 31 out of 66 students in English Literature Study Program in the Faculty of Languages and Literature of one state university in Makassar. The data were collected by distributing questionnaire and by interviewing half of the participants. The items in the questionnaire were adapted from Davis (1989) theory about Technology Acceptance Model Articles. Supporting data were taken from the result of an interview.  This research found that items in both perceived ease of use and perceived usefulness majority received a positive response. Students’ knowledge of Instagram is an advantage in using it as a writing practice medium. The distraction from the learning process is the downside that frequently happened while using it. This indicates that Instagram is a useful media for writing practice.

Abstract

This research aimed at identifying the English teachers’ pedagogical competence in planning the teaching and learning process. The profile of English teachers’ pedagogical competence in planning the teaching and learning process was based on the National Standard of Education, in section 28, sub-section 3 point a. The researcher employed descriptive evaluative method. The subjects of this research were four English teachers from different schools of Madrasah Aliyah in Kabupaten Enrekang. The purpose of the research was to describe the teachers’ pedagogical competence in planning the teaching and learning process. Based on the result and discussion, the four teachers had different quality in terms of pedagogical competence in planning the teaching and learning process. The scores of the teachers were: teacher 1 = 4 (very good), teacher 2 = 3 (good), teacher 3 = 3 (good), and teacher 4 = 3 (good). Based on the result and discussion, it could be concluded that the four teachers had good quality in terms of pedagogical competence in regard to planning the teaching and learning process. The four teachers realized the importance of the arrangement of lesson plan before teaching the students in the classroom.

Abstract

Teaching English cannot be separated from teaching language skills, including Listening. This study aims to find out the views of students regarding the effectiveness of online learning technique applied by lecturer in teaching listening course. This research is a qualitative descriptive study. Data was collected through a questionnaire. The data collected were analyzed qualitatively by describing the information obtained through a questionnaire. The subjects of this study were 4th semester students of the English Education study program, Faculty of Languages and Literature, Universitas Negeri Makassar who had programmed the Intensive Listening course. The results showed that based on the results of the questionnaire, about 67% of students considered that online listening teaching was quite effective because the methods and materials presented by the lecturers were well received by them so that their listening skills improved. 10% of students think that they have problems in learning listening online because of internet network disturbances and limited internet quota. In addition, there are also difficulties with vocabulary. However, about 10% of students think that teaching listening offline or face-to-face is more effective than teaching listening online. They prefer to interact directly with lecturers. Around 13% of students think that teaching listening both offline and online is the same. It can be concluded that online listening teaching is effective in improving students' knowledge and skills as long as it is supported by methods, materials and devices that are in accordance with learning objectives.

Abstract

This study aims to determine the perceptions of the teachers about the use of code-mixing in teaching English. The researchers used a mixed-method triangulation research design (quantitative-qualitative). To achieve the research objectives, the data collected is the result of observation, interview, and questionnaire. The sample in this research was the teacher who taught in a third-year English class in SMP 4 Bantimurung. The results of data analysis showed that the perceptions of teachers had positive perceptions about the use of code-mixing in teaching English as evidenced by the results of observations and interviews which showed positive responses to the use of code-mixing and also supported by accurate data from a questionnaire where there was mean score 68 for teacher. The reason why a teacher had a positive perception of code mixing in teaching English is that the teacher considers that code-mixing can help teachers to make students more actively participate in taking English lessons. The use of L1 or Indonesian by the teacher can help students understand teacher instructions, subject matter, assignments, and even exams. In addition, students can also improve their vocabulary and how to pronounce new vocabulary acquired during the teaching-learning process.
